1955 18th Ave in San Francisco sold for $1,900,000 on June 16, 2026 — 29 days after coming on the market at $1,150,000. That works out to $1,520 per square foot for a 2-bedroom, 1-bath single-family home built in 1939. The 1,250 sq ft house sits in Inner Parkside, which Houseberry scores 4.2/5 overall, 4.0/5 for schools and 5.0/5 for safety — 9th of 92 neighborhoods in San Francisco — with a median home price of $2.25M.
